Rocky is a dachshund/pug looking for an experienced dog carer/owner.
He looks like a tiny mini labrador with a dashie personality.
He's a really loving guy and he doesn't take long to warm up to you, you just need to give him time and space and he’s not a fan of fussing all over him.
Rocky is very affectionate once he is comfortable with you and likes to lay on top of you, he's just helping to keep you warm.
Rocky loves his toys and a game of tug-o-war, he prefers it when he wins.
He is good with most dogs but can be a bit too boisterous at times with his play style. He loves to explore and play in the yard but more importantly he loves to spend time with his human and needs to be allowed inside and sleep inside .
Rocky has been assed by our trainer who says he has a great level of obedience and looks to you for direction, he would love and he would benefit from someone willing to continue his training. She’s says he’s a really nice little dog who is just a bit timid and puts on a big front.
He is crate trained and is excellent inside the home.
Rocky just wants a quiet home and few visitors, this makes him happy, just him and his people.
He has a sensitive tummy so he will need a good quality diet.
He is fine left at home for a few hours, inside , and no issues. When he is left indoors, he will usually just make himself a comfy space in the sun until you return.

Adoption details
The adoption process is as follows.
1. Please Apply here
https://www.bestfriendsrescue.com/adoptionform/
2. Please include as much information as possible, ask questions in the comments section of the application.
3. All suitable applicants will be contacted via phone and given a phone interview.
4. After the phone interview we will make arrangements for you to meet the dog. ALL PEOPLE LIVING IN THE HOME MUST ATTEND MEETING
5. After meeting, and if all parties are agreeable, we will have a home inspection.
Generally we ask the you go home and consider everything you’ve learnt. Discuss with family, sleep on it and contact us the next day.

An adoption fee applies to each animal to cover only the basic veterinary procedures, and each adoption goes out on a 21 day settling in period, if the dog is returned in this period, and you’ve spoken to our trainer for assistance, and the dog is returned in good health, mentally and physically, and all their belongings and paperwork are returned, then we provide a refund less $50 admin fee. This is not a trial, but in case of any unknown or unforeseen circumstances.
The adoption process is as follows
✅Everyone that lives in the home will meet the dog with the carer
✅We ask everyone go home again and discuss and think about overnight and contact us the next day
✅This also gives the carer a chance to think about suitability
✅Then if everyone agrees we then require a home inspection, or at least photos of the home yard and fences.
✅Then the adoption fee is paid and once that clears our account you are free to arrange with the carer to collect
✅The adoption paperwork comes out in 14 days in which time you are required to register and change chip over
